What You’ll Need: 

  • Graduation from an accredited college/university with bachelor’s degree in administration, Nutrition, or Nursing. 
  • Current IBCLC certification or eligible to sit for exam. If not currently certified, must apply to sit for the exam at the next scheduled application date.
  • Basic Cardiac Life Support (BCLS) required.  
  • Prior experience in a neonatal intensive care or pediatric unit as an IBCLC preferred.
  • Bilingual (Spanish/English) skills preferred. 

How You’ll Impact Patient Care: 

Exemplifies expertise in addressing complex lactation challenges. Assumes responsibility for enlightening and supporting mothers of Brenner infants in fundamental breastfeeding techniques and offers guidance in resolving issues faced by mothers encountering breastfeeding difficulties. Additionally, conducts staff training in providing breastfeeding consultations and diligently curates breastfeeding resources. Furthermore, oversees the collection and analysis of breastfeeding statistics and actively contributes to research aimed at enhancing related outcomes. Collaborates seamlessly with the interdisciplinary team in optimizing nutritional care and proactively preventing complications for pediatric patients related to breastfeeding.

Job responsibilities include, but are not limited to:  

 1. Provides consultation in collaboration with the multidisciplinary team to mothers of patients in the management of breastfeeding to promote optimal patient outcomes.

2. Educates staff and complex breastfeeding management.

3. Collaborates with the interdisciplinary care team in monitoring breastfeeding progress of mothers and modifying the plan of care to promote optimal outcomes.

4. Maintains breastfeeding statistics for Brenner Children's Hospital and Birth Center. 

5. Develops policies and procedures as needed for Lactation Consultant services, breastfeeding equipment and resources and participates in performance and quality improvement activities and outcomes projects.

About Advocate Health 

Advocate Health is the third-largest nonprofit, integrated health system in the United States, created from the combination of Advocate Aurora Health and Atrium Health. Providing care under the names Advocate Health Care in Illinois; Atrium Health in the Carolinas, Georgia and Alabama; and Aurora Health Care in Wisconsin, Advocate Health is a national leader in clinical innovation, health outcomes, consumer experience and value-based care. Head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, Advocate Health services nearly 6 million patients and is engaged in hundreds of clinical trials and research studies, with Wake Forest University School of Medicine serving as the academic core of the enterprise. It is nationally recognized for its expertise in cardiology, neurosciences, oncology, pediatrics and rehabilitation, as well as organ transplants, burn treatments and specialized musculoskeletal programs. Advocate Health employs 155,000 teammates across 69 hospitals and over 1,000 care locations, and offers one of the nation’s largest graduate medical education programs with over 2,000 residents and fellows across more than 200 programs. Committed to providing equitable care for all, Advocate Health provides more than $6 billion in annual community benefits.
